- Enlightened Horizon –> PrairieNew MapsWe’re thrilled to be releasing 8 new maps with the Dynasties of the East expansion on November 4th, but you can get a sneak preview of three of them already as we add them directly into our Season Twelve Map Pool.CratersA meteor shower leaves behind deep craters that scar the surface of the land; some have filled with water and provide limited fishing opportunities while others contain meteorite fragments which can be gathered by daring Villagers. Meteorites can be mined for both Gold and Stone at the same time, but such a precious resource will surely be a catalyst for conflict.CanyonA waterlogged canyon snakes its way through the center of the map, dividing teams equally on either side. Teams can reach each other by ramps that lead down to the base of the canyon and by crossing the shallow water there, perhaps catching the glint of Relics reflecting on the water’s surface. Town Centers perch precariously on the Canyon edge; it’s rumored that if you watch carefully enough, enemy movements can be seen at the edge of the fog of war.Ocean GatewaySurrounded by rugged cliffs, the four gateways provide critical access to the bounty of fish and naval trade available at the map’s edge. However, limited space for docks and wide-open flanks make Ocean Gateway a challenging balancing act between both land and water.Map Pool BiomesWith this release we have also updated all the available biomes for each map while playing in ranked or unranked, meaning that you’ll see more biome variation than before and the appearance of new biomes in multiplayer matches.

You should notice faster queue times in Quick Match and Ranked!Manor ReworkHouse of Lancaster’s gameplay will be changing this season, with a much-requested rework to how Manors generate resources. Manors now generate less resources passively, instead Manors have an aura in which Villagers generate Food and Wood when they are within the Aura. Lancaster players will need to strategically place their Manors to make sure they capture as many Villagers as possible.

We began The Book of Outcasts four years ago, but the real development started in spring 2024. It’s by far the most complex project we’ve ever made. Combining a visual novel with an RPG dungeon crawler turned out to be a real challenge for our small team.
And because that wasn’t complicated enough, we decided to add both playable genders — giving you the option to play as either a male or female character.
Later came another big test: when the “payment processors” issue appeared, we had to reorganize the entire project and remove a lot of content. Graphics, text, animations — once you cut so much, the whole system stops working like before. Sometimes we even had to read through 250,000 words line by line just to remove certain “triggering” terms.
But despite all that, it was fun. I truly enjoyed reading and reworking the story. Sometimes I couldn’t wait for the next script from the writer just to find out what happens next.
It was also a great learning experience — I even learned 2D animation! When you meet the final boss, you’ll see what I mean.

	Thank you all for supporting the game. This update adds new stages and accessories as rewards for player achievements.
Seasonal stages are themed around a specific time of year. These will be self-contained, have their own maximum score and star rating, as well as rewards such as accessories or companions for your 🐔.
The first one to be released is the Cemetery stage, to celebrate the Halloween season, and 3 more will be released in future updates.
A new menu called the bag is included, which contains the accessories or companions that the player can unlock and equip once certain achievements are completed.
Initially, there are 2 accessories and 2 companions available; new ones will be added in future updates.
